511 }
512
513 void frame_grab_client(ObFrame *self, ObClient *client)
514 {
515     self->client = client;
516
517     /* reparent the client to the frame */
518     XReparentWindow(ob_display, client->window, self->plate, 0, 0);
519     /*
520       When reparenting the client window, it is usually not mapped yet, since
521       this occurs from a MapRequest. However, in the case where Openbox is
522       starting up, the window is already mapped, so we'll see unmap events for
523       it. There are 2 unmap events generated that we see, one with the 'event'
524       member set the root window, and one set to the client, but both get
525       handled and need to be ignored.
526     */
527     if (ob_state() == OB_STATE_STARTING)
528         client->ignore_unmaps += 2;
529
530     /* select the event mask on the client's parent (to receive config/map
531        req's) the ButtonPress is to catch clicks on the client border */
532     XSelectInput(ob_display, self->plate, PLATE_EVENTMASK);
533
534     frame_adjust_area(self, TRUE, TRUE, FALSE);
535
536     /* map the client so it maps when the frame does */
537     XMapWindow(ob_display, client->window);
538
539     /* set all the windows for the frame in the window_map */
540     g_hash_table_insert(window_map, &self->window, client);
541     g_hash_table_insert(window_map, &self->plate, client);
542     g_hash_table_insert(window_map, &self->title, client);
543     g_hash_table_insert(window_map, &self->label, client);
544     g_hash_table_insert(window_map, &self->max, client);
545     g_hash_table_insert(window_map, &self->close, client);
546     g_hash_table_insert(window_map, &self->desk, client);
547     g_hash_table_insert(window_map, &self->shade, client);
548     g_hash_table_insert(window_map, &self->icon, client);
549     g_hash_table_insert(window_map, &self->iconify, client);
550     g_hash_table_insert(window_map, &self->handle, client);
551     g_hash_table_insert(window_map, &self->lgrip, client);
552     g_hash_table_insert(window_map, &self->rgrip, client);
553     g_hash_table_insert(window_map, &self->tltresize, client);
554     g_hash_table_insert(window_map, &self->tllresize, client);
555     g_hash_table_insert(window_map, &self->trtresize, client);
556     g_hash_table_insert(window_map, &self->trrresize, client);
557 }

559 void frame_release_client(ObFrame *self, ObClient *client)
560 {
561     XEvent ev;
562     gboolean reparent = TRUE;
563
564     g_assert(self->client == client);
565
566     /* check if the app has already reparented its window away */
567     while (XCheckTypedWindowEvent(ob_display, client->window,
568                                   ReparentNotify, &ev))
569     {
570         /* This check makes sure we don't catch our own reparent action to
571            our frame window. This doesn't count as the app reparenting itself
572            away of course.
573
574            Reparent events that are generated by us are just discarded here.
575            They are of no consequence to us anyhow.
576         */
577         if (ev.xreparent.parent != self->plate) {
578             reparent = FALSE;
579             XPutBackEvent(ob_display, &ev);
580             break;
581         }
582     }
583
584     if (reparent) {
585         /* according to the ICCCM - if the client doesn't reparent itself,
586            then we will reparent the window to root for them */
587         XReparentWindow(ob_display, client->window,
588                         RootWindow(ob_display, ob_screen),
589                         client->area.x,
590                         client->area.y);
591     }
592
593     /* remove all the windows for the frame from the window_map */
594     g_hash_table_remove(window_map, &self->window);
595     g_hash_table_remove(window_map, &self->plate);
596     g_hash_table_remove(window_map, &self->title);
597     g_hash_table_remove(window_map, &self->label);
598     g_hash_table_remove(window_map, &self->max);
599     g_hash_table_remove(window_map, &self->close);
600     g_hash_table_remove(window_map, &self->desk);
601     g_hash_table_remove(window_map, &self->shade);
602     g_hash_table_remove(window_map, &self->icon);
603     g_hash_table_remove(window_map, &self->iconify);
604     g_hash_table_remove(window_map, &self->handle);
605     g_hash_table_remove(window_map, &self->lgrip);
606     g_hash_table_remove(window_map, &self->rgrip);
607     g_hash_table_remove(window_map, &self->tltresize);
608     g_hash_table_remove(window_map, &self->tllresize);
609     g_hash_table_remove(window_map, &self->trtresize);
610     g_hash_table_remove(window_map, &self->trrresize);
611
612     ob_main_loop_timeout_remove_data(ob_main_loop, flash_timeout, self, TRUE);
613
614     frame_free(self);
615 }

836 void frame_client_gravity(ObFrame *self, gint *x, gint *y)
837 {
838     /* horizontal */
839     switch (self->client->gravity) {
840     default:
841     case NorthWestGravity:
842     case SouthWestGravity:
843     case WestGravity:
844         break;
845
846     case NorthGravity:
847     case SouthGravity:
848     case CenterGravity:
849         *x -= (self->size.left + self->size.right) / 2;
850         break;
851
852     case NorthEastGravity:
853     case SouthEastGravity:
854     case EastGravity:
855         *x -= self->size.left + self->size.right;
856         break;
857
858     case ForgetGravity:
859     case StaticGravity:
860         *x -= self->size.left;
861         break;
862     }
863
864     /* vertical */
865     switch (self->client->gravity) {
866     default:
867     case NorthWestGravity:
868     case NorthEastGravity:
869     case NorthGravity:
870         break;
871
872     case CenterGravity:
873     case EastGravity:
874     case WestGravity:
875         *y -= (self->size.top + self->size.bottom) / 2;
876         break;
877
878     case SouthWestGravity:
879     case SouthEastGravity:
880     case SouthGravity:
881         *y -= self->size.top + self->size.bottom;
882         break;
883
884     case ForgetGravity:
885     case StaticGravity:
886         *y -= self->size.top;
887         break;
888     }
889 }
